Position Description
Job Captain (JC) possesses the ability to handle complex assignments by demonstrating a strong technical understanding of construction materials, methods, and specifications. They direct and supervise Designers at all levels, overseeing project assignments and ensuring alignment with project goals, while working closely with PMs or above to coordinate project phases and align design deliverables with project schedules and budgets. The Job Captain position is the bridge between the Designers and the Project Managers operationally and for career advancement.
Responsibilities
- Manages and supervises junior staff (Designer III and lower) and reports to Project Manager I or above
- May have similar responsibilities to Project Manager I on smaller projects
- Typically works on 1-2 primary projects
- Introduction to client relationship management [beyond meeting attendance]
- Responsible for all phases of project development including document planning and coordination as well as detail development, design development and preparation of project presentation drawings and construction documents
- Focus on learning project scheduling and budgets
- May lead client presentations / meetings
- Is responsible for consultant coordination
- Understands and manages more complex permitting processes [CEQA / variances, etc]
- Produces outline specs
- Leads CA process
- Provide technical expertise to ensure coordinated, high quality construction documents
- Focus on QC and excellent team leadership
Qualifications
- Accredited degree in Architecture
- 5-6 years minimum of professional, high-end residential experience
- May be licensed or non-licensed but close to license
- Excellent ability to design, draw, model and communicate visually
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ills
- Proactive, organized, and collaborative with exceptional problem-solving skills
- Advanced skill in 3D modeling/BIM software and 2D drafting (ArchiCAD strongly preferred, but not required)
- Ability to manage complex assignments and/or small to midsized teams
- Technical knowledge of Type V construction preferred
